Product Overview: TSC2007IYZGT from Texas Instruments
The TSC2007IYZGT is a cutting-edge touch screen controller designed by the renowned semiconductor manufacturer, Texas Instruments. This innovative component is part of Texas Instruments' extensive range of interface devices, specifically tailored for touch-sensitive applications. The TSC2007IYZGT is an essential element for modern touch screen solutions, offering precision and reliability for an enhanced user experience.
With its 4-wire resistive touch screen controller, the TSC2007IYZGT provides accurate and responsive performance. It features an on-board 12-bit analog-to-digital converter (ADC) that ensures high-resolution touch coordinates. Furthermore, this controller includes an integrated circuit that supports a wide operational voltage range, making it versatile for various power supply requirements.
The device operates efficiently with a low power consumption profile, which is critical for battery-powered applications such as portable electronics. The TSC2007IYZGT also boasts an automatic power-down feature, which helps to conserve energy when the touch screen is not in use, further extending the battery life of the end product.
Connectivity is a breeze with the TSC2007IYZGT, thanks to its I²C serial interface, which allows for easy integration into existing systems with minimal pin count. This interface also facilitates quick communication with microcontrollers or processors, ensuring a seamless user interface experience.
The compact form factor of the TSC2007IYZGT, available in a tiny VFBGA package, is perfect for space-constrained applications. It is especially suitable for handheld devices, personal digital assistants, point-of-sale terminals, and other touch-enabled devices that require a small footprint without compromising on functionality.
